Ticket: Vault lockout blocking FormulaCage sandbox deploy

The Quillstone secrets vault sealed itself after three failed unseal attempts, so the sandbox policy for user-supplied formulas in CalcNest can't be rolled out. Evaluation workers are running with the old, weaker jail config until resolved. To unseal manually, use the recovery passphrase below.

vault phrase of bagaf-kajeg = jorath-feniel-briir-siliel-ralix

The Givewick receipt mailer now renders donor names and amounts server-side and sends via the new templating pipeline. Changes: receipts are generated from a sanitized snapshot rather than live records, attachments are PDF-only, and the retry queue encrypts payloads at rest. Security review should confirm that no donor data persists in worker logs and that template variables are escaped. Rollout is blocked pending sign-off. The engineer responsible for this change, and who will address review findings, is named below.

account owner for fajep-yagef: Kasix Eliiel

Q3 Planning Note — Board Distribution Only

The Ferrowick "Tidemark" launch remains scheduled for early Q3, pending final certification in the Ostbryn market. Marketing spend is phased across three waves, with channel partners confirmed. Risks are documented in the appendix. The confidential commercial strategy underpinning this timing is summarized immediately below for the board's review.

internal memo for kawip-hadug: Headcount on the Wenwyn team goes from 7 to 140 by the end of January. Gross margin on Wenwyn came in at 20 percent against a plan of 15 percent.

**Q: Why did the cleanup bot delete a customer's branch?**

A: Tidybranch only deletes branches with no commits in 90 days, no open pull requests, and no protection rule. Deleted branches are recoverable for 30 days via the restore command. If a customer claims an active branch was removed, collect the branch name and repo, then check the bot's action log on the internal page here:

operations page: https://jenkins.zemvarcloud.local/job/merge_requests/repo/build/73930b4b30f0a8ed